Ingredients

  • 1 pound ground beef
  • 1 cup orzo pasta
  • 1 medium onion, finely chopped
  • 1 bell pepper (red or green), diced
  • 1 can (14.5 ounces) diced tomatoes, with juice
  • 1 cup frozen peas
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 2 cups beef broth
  • 1 teaspoon dried oregano
  • 1 teaspoon dried basil
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)

Instructions

Step 1: Sauté the Aromatics
In a large skillet, heat olive oil over medium heat. Add the finely chopped onion and cook until translucent, about 3–4 minutes.
Step 2: Add Garlic and Peppers
Stir in the minced garlic and diced bell pepper; sauté for an additional 2–3 minutes until the bell pepper softens.
Step 3: Brown the Beef
Increase heat to medium-high. Add ground beef and cook until browned, breaking it up with a spatula, about 5–7 minutes. Drain excess fat if necessary.
Step 4: Combine Base Ingredients
Add diced tomatoes (with juice), beef broth, dried oregano, dried basil, salt, and black pepper. Stir well to combine.
Step 5: First Simmer
Bring to a boil, then reduce heat to medium-low; simmer for 10 minutes.
Step 6: Cook the Orzo
Add orzo pasta, stirring to combine. Cover and cook for 10–12 minutes, or until orzo is tender and most of the liquid is absorbed. Stir occasionally to prevent sticking.
Step 10: Final Additions
Fold in frozen peas and cook for another 2–3 minutes until heated through.
Step 11: Add Cheese
Remove from heat. Stir in grated Parmesan cheese until melted and incorporated.
Step 12: Garnish and Serve
Serve hot, garnished with fresh parsley.

To ensure the best results, remember to stir the orzo occasionally while it is simmering with the lid on; this prevents the small pasta grains from sticking to the bottom of the skillet. If you prefer a leaner dish, be sure to drain the excess fat thoroughly after browning the ground beef.

You can easily customize this dinner by substituting ground turkey or chicken for a leaner protein option. For an extra nutritional boost, stir in vegetables like spinach, zucchini, or mushrooms during the simmering process. You can also experiment with different herbs like thyme or rosemary to vary the flavor profile.

Frequently Asked Recipe Questions

Can I use a different type of ground meat?

Yes, you can easily substitute ground turkey or chicken for the beef if you prefer a leaner option or simply want to vary the flavor profile of the dish. Adjust cooking time as needed to ensure it's cooked through.

What other vegetables can I add to this skillet?

This skillet meal is very versatile. Consider adding vegetables like fresh spinach (stirred in at the end), sliced zucchini, or sautéed mushrooms along with the bell peppers for extra nutrition and flavor. Stir them in during the simmering stage.

How can I make this dish creamier?

For an extra creamy texture, stir in a splash of heavy cream, a spoonful of cream cheese, or some shredded mozzarella along with the Parmesan at the very end of cooking. This will enhance richness and create a luscious consistency.

Can this dish be prepared ahead of time?

While best enjoyed fresh, this dish reheats well. You can prepare it completely and store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at gently on the stovetop or in the microwave, adding a splash of broth if it seems too dry.

What kind of orzo should I use for this meal?

Standard orzo pasta, which is a small, rice-shaped pasta, works perfectly for this dish. No need for any special varieties; simply follow the general cooking time guidelines, though it will cook directly in the skillet here, absorbing the broth.
